Recovering from a failure that occurred during phases 2 to 4 in the remote path from the primary storage system of the source GAD pair to the primary storage system of the target GAD pair

  1. Recover from the failure in the remote path.
  2. Resynchronize the temporary GAD pair by specifying the P-VOL.
    Command example:
    pairresync –g oraHA01 –IH0
  3. Verify that the pair status of the temporary GAD pair has changed to COPY.
    Command example:
    pairdisplay –g oraHA01 –fcxe –IH0
    Group PairVol(L/R) (Port#,TID, LU),Seq#, LDEV#.P/S,
    Status,Fence,%, P-LDEV# M CTG JID AP EM E-Seq# E-LDEV# R/W
    QM DM P PR
    oraHA01 dev01(L) (CL1-C-0, 0, 0)411111 1111.P-VOL COPY
    NEVER , 55 1111 - - 1 1 - - - L/M - D
    N D
    oraHA01 dev01(R) (CL1-C-0, 0, 0)833333 1111.S-VOL COPY
    NEVER ,----- 1111 - - 1 1 - - - B/B - D
    N D
    
  4. Continue data migration from the procedure that you performed before the failure.
